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C problems call for emergency service. Acknowledging these problems can assist you know when to require professional aid: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working completely, especially throughout extreme weather, it's more than just an trouble-- it can be dangerous. Our emergency HVAC professionals can detect and repair the issue quickly, restoring your home's comfort and security.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Strange seem like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system often signal a severe mechanical issue that could result in larger concerns if not resolved quickly. Similarly, uncommon smells may show electrical issues or even gas leaks. Our expert HVAC specialists can determine these issues and make necessary repair work before they end up being hazardous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can harm your home and result in mold development. Our professionals locate the source of leaks and repair them correctly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ks lower your air conditioning system's cooling capacity and can harm the environment. They require professional attention as refrigerant handling require spec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ical parts in your HVAC system posture fire hazards and need to be resolved right away by qualified specialists. Our HVAC contractors have the training to safely fix electrical problems.

When your heater fails throughout cold weather, it develops uncomfortable and possibly hazardous conditions. Our emergency HVAC contractors fix all heating system issues, consisting of:

  • Pilot light or ignition control issues
  • Faulty thermostats
  • Mechanical wear and breakdowns
  • Stopped up filters
  • Blower motor failures
  • Heat exchanger fractures
  • Control system malfunctions

Heating Unit Maintenance

Regular maintenance avoids many heating issues and extends the life of your system. Our professional HVAC professionals perform comprehensive upkeep services that include:

  •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
  • Inspecting combustion effectiveness
  • Checking safety controls
  • Cleaning or changing filters
  • Examining electrical connections
  • Oiling moving parts
  • Cleaning burners and changing the flame

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ted air flow makes your system work more difficult and lowers convenience. Our HVAC professionals identify airflow problems, whether triggered by duct problems, filthy filters, or fan problems.
  • Uneven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ct issues, insulation issues, or an poorly sized system. Our expert HVAC professionals can detect these problems and suggest services.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system switches on and off often, it wastes energy and breaks components quicker. Our HVAC specialists can determine whether the issue originates from a blocked filter, improper thermostat settings, or something more major.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ected boosts in energy costs frequently indicate HVAC inadequacy. Our professionals carry out energy effectiveness assessments to determine the cause and recommend en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ems need to help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er season or too dry in winter, our HVAC professionals can suggest options to improve com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what appears like a system failure is actually a thermostat problem. Our HVAC professionals can fix or change thermostats and assist you update to programmable or clever models for much better convenience control and energy cost savings.
